This is a really good hire. He was at Clemson from 2006-10, which was the first few seasons of Dabo and likely helped set the foundation for what Clemson turned into. Was the WR coach at Alabama from 2013-17, and was recruited really well. 3 10 win seasons in a row too.

Great hire. This guy has raised the profile of Louisiana (even after their rebrand from UL-Lafayette). He's upped their recruiting as well, as they've consistently been first in their conference on Signing Day. And he has major conference experience as an assistant at Clemson, FSU, and Alabama.
